Key Distinctions Between Decentraland Axie Infinity

  • While both platforms leverage the Ethereum blockchain, Decentraland is a virtual world platform promoting creation of unique environments, applications, and is run by its user community, whereas Axie Infinity is a game based on collecting, breeding, and battling monsters.
  • Decentraland’s tokens LAND, MANA, and Estate govern virtual land ownership, in-world transactions, and bundled land parcels. In contrast, Axie Infinity uses SLP and AXS tokens for in-game progression, rewards, and governance.
  • Decentraland’s open-source nature and DAO governance allow user-controlled policy changes and monetization opportunities. On the contrary, Axie Infinity’s business is heavily geared toward its play-to-earn model.
  • Axie Infinity has been subject to a significant hack incident, which had an impact on its player numbers and Ethereum value, while Decentraland has not.

What Is Decentraland Who’s It For?

Decentraland is an Ethereum-based 3D virtual world platform that was developed in 2015 by Argentine professionals Ari Meilich and Esteban Ordano. Governed by user community it owns two native tokens named LAND and MANA that facilitate transactions and activities within this digitally parallel economy. This unique platform stimulates an environment that allows the creation of distinct landscapes, marketplaces, and apps spearheaded by the user population empowering real-world-like interaction and exploration.

This platform is perfect for tech-savvy individuals looking to delve into a virtual economy backed by cryptocurrencies. Educators, art enthusiasts, traders, gamers, and even brands can utilize this platform to their advantage. As users can create and monetize their experiences, it opens up a host of opportunities for creative entrepreneurs.

What Is Axie Infinity and Who’s It For?

Axie Infinity is a blockchain-based game designed and launched by Sky Mavis, primarily focused on turn-based monster battles. Utilizing NFTs for in-game characters and land plots, it brings about an engaging symbiosis of online gaming and blockchain, subsequently granting players real ownership of virtual assets.

This alluring game is tailored to online gaming aficionados who harbor an interest in the digital crypto space. Gamers who fancy strategy-based gameplay by combining different Axies, crypto enthusiasts and enthusiasts who enjoy collecting and trading NFTs will appreciate Axie Infinity.
